This year's annual royal family Christmas meal takes place amidst ongoing health concerns for King Charles and Queen Camilla, as well as scrutiny surrounding Prince Andrew's alleged links to a Chinese spy.

William and Kate were not the only couple to cancel their attendance, however, as Prince Andrew and his ex-wife Sarah Ferguson were also absent, presumably due to the former’s connection to an alleged Chinese spy. King Charles will welcome Prince Edward and his wife, Sophie, the Duchess of Edinburgh, who arrived at the Palace today (December 19). The meal also comes at a time when both monarchs have been recovering from serious illnesses: Charles from cancer, and Camilla from pneumonia.

This annual festive gathering, first established by the late Queen Elizabeth II, sees a large group of royal family members assemble at Buckingham Palace for a meal before moving their celebrations to Sandringham Estate, the family’s private country retreat. It’s expected that William and Kate will then join the rest of their family at Sandringham, and attend church together at St. Mary Magdalene. The event has drawn extra attention due to two issues affecting the royals. On one hand, both King Charles and Queen Camilla endured troublesome health diagnoses and have been limiting their public appearances as they recover. On the other, Prince Andrew continues to face scrutiny from British authorities, as his alleged ties to a Chinese spy are being investigated. The prince has been a controversial figure since 2019, when his friendship with disgraced sex offender Jeffrey Epstein surfaced. King Charles has been battling an undisclosed form of cancer since February 2024, causing a temporary pause in his public duties. The diagnosis caused the monarch to take a temporary pause in his duties after the news was shared in February. He resumed his public duties at the end of April, taking the chance to visit a cancer treatment center alongside Queen Camilla
